What Exactly Is Glutathione?
Glutathione is a tripeptide — a small protein made from three amino acids: glutamine, glycine, and cysteine. Unlike most antioxidants you consume through food (like vitamin C or vitamin E), glutathione is made inside your cells, working at the very source of cellular damage.
It performs several essential functions in the body, including neutralising free radicals and reactive oxygen species (ROS), regenerating other antioxidants like vitamins C and E, supporting liver detoxification (Phase I and Phase II), binding to heavy metals and toxins to enable excretion, regulating immune function and inflammatory response, and protecting mitochondria — the powerhouses of your cells.
No other single molecule performs this breadth of protective roles. That's why researchers often refer to it as the "master antioxidant."
The Decline Problem: Why Your Glutathione Levels Drop After 20
Clinical research shows that glutathione levels decline by approximately 10% per decade after your mid-twenties. By the time you're 60, your intracellular glutathione can be half of what it was in your twenties.
This decline is accelerated by chronic stress, poor diet, environmental toxins (air pollution, pesticides, heavy metals), alcohol consumption, certain medications (including paracetamol), illness and chronic inflammation, and intense exercise without adequate recovery nutrition.
Lower glutathione doesn't just mean slower recovery from illness. It means every cell in your body is under greater oxidative stress every single day. Over time, this contributes to accelerated ageing, reduced energy, and increased susceptibility to chronic conditions.
Can You Simply Take Glutathione as a Supplement?
Here's where most people get confused. Standard oral glutathione supplements face a significant challenge: the digestive system breaks glutathione down before it can reach your cells. Research published in the European Journal of Nutrition found that while liposomal glutathione and some oral forms do have some benefit, the delivery challenge remains significant.
This is why scientists explored an entirely different approach — providing the body with the precise precursors and cofactors it needs to produce more glutathione itself, inside the cell where it's needed.
